    A module \(M\) is called closed weak supplemented if for any closed submodule \(N\) of \(M\), there is a submodule \(K\) of \(M\) such that \(M=N+K\) and \(K\cap N\) is small in \(N\). Several properties of closed weak supplemented modules are studied. For example, any direct summand of a closed weak supplemented module is also closed weak supplemented. A ring \(R\) is closed weak supplemented if the module \(R_R\) is closed weak supplemented. It is shown that a ring \(R\) is closed weak supplemented if and only if the \(n\)-by-\(n\) matrix ring \(M_n(R)\) over \(R\) is closed weak supplemented for any positive integer \(n\).
